Fuel cell system fluid recovery
View Patent ↗A system and method are provided for fluid collection within a fuel cell system. The fluid collection device includes a fluid collection container which has a gas inlet, a gas outlet, at least one fluid inlet, and a fluid outlet. The at least one fluid inlet allows condensate to enter the fluid collection container. A fluid is contained within the fluid collection container. The gas inlet allows a purge gas to enter the fluid collection container to substantially purge the atmosphere of the fluid collection container through the gas outlet.
1. A method for recovering fluid from a fuel cell system, said method comprising:
providing said fuel cell system with a fluid collection container, said fluid collection container having a gas inlet and a gas outlet;
routing a flow of the fuel cell system through a liquid trap seal to collect condensate from said fuel cell system, said liquid trap seal being separate from said fluid collection container;
transporting said condensate from said liquid trap seal to said fluid collection container; and
purging said fluid collection container, the purging comprising providing a cathode exhaust stream to said gas inlet, wherein said cathode exhaust stream flows through said fluid collection container and exits through said gas outlet.
2. The method of claim 1 , wherein said condensate comprises deionized water.
3. The method of claim 2 , further comprising filtering said condensate to remove ions and particulates imparted to said condensate from the cathode exhaust stream.
4. The method of claim 1 , further comprising:
transporting additional condensate from additional liquid trap seals to said fluid collection container, each of said additional traps being separate from said fluid collection container.
5. The method of claim 1 , wherein the liquid trap seal comprises a needle and float to block communication of gas through the liquid trap seal when the seal does not contain fluid.
